§ 24-4.5-4-109 — Existing insurance; choice of insurer

Existing Insurance; Choice of Insurer — If a creditor requires insurance, upon notice to the creditor the debtor shall have the option of providing the required insurance through an existing policy of insurance owned or controlled by the debtor, or through a policy to be obtained and paid for by the debtor, but the creditor may for reasonable cause decline the insurance provided by the debtor. Formerly: Acts 1971, P.L.366, SEC.5.
